State-owned Mishra Dhatu Nigam Limited (MIDHANI)'s new Wide Plate mill facility at its existing plant in Hyderabad will be inaugurated by President Droupadi Murmu on Tuesday (27 December).
MIDHANI, a government-owned metallurgical company which was established in 1973 and is under the control of the Ministry of Defence, specialises in the production of a wide range of alloys, including superalloys, titanium, and special steel.
In addition, MIDHANI has developed technology to produce high strength titanium alloys for space, nuclear, and defense applications.
The Wide Plate Mill, which was built with an investment of approximately Rs 500 crore, is capable of rolling slabs of various alloys and has a unique capacity to roll ultra-high strength steel to very low thicknesses due to its high rolling force.
The company said that 3-meter width of the plate which can be rolled in newly commissioned mill makes it unique in world.
The new Wide Plate Mill is expected to meet the requirements of special steel plates for national strategic programmes and serve as a national facility for the development of wide plates that will meet present and future needs, as well as serve as an import substitute, the company added.
